    It's also typical Canadian food. I thought it would be common anywhere bread, cheese, butter, skillets and heat exist. It's the most logical combination of those things. Put cheese on bread, put butter on heated skillet, put cheesed bread on heated buttered skillet until the cheese melts.

    You can also put sliced meat on there. You can use good bread and multiple cheeses to make it fancy. Optionally have it with soup, chop the sandwich into triangles and dip it in the soup. It's good.
